Transaction 16c0461550c0814abe31a5184ff503cbb983dab2b8fafddcb0f0c472d49ff0b3

2 Input
2 Outputs
  • 16c0461550c0814abe31a5184ff503cbb983dab2b8fafddcb0f0c472d49ff0b3:0
  • value  1358965
    address  3C2mFEPptraPTPkVDzKXbgMJuaeguPFbzY
  • 16c0461550c0814abe31a5184ff503cbb983dab2b8fafddcb0f0c472d49ff0b3:1
  • value  21726488
    address  17ze29KN7m57Tu5d1QtxuSnQnvA6hpHDdN